Celsius energy drink cans were accidentally filled with boozy seltzer High Noon and sold at stores across the country, resulting in a widespread recall of the spiked seltzer.
The recall affects two production lots of High Noon Beach Variety packs. While the cans contain vodka seltzer, the company says they were mislabeled as “sparkling blue razz”-flavored Celsius ...
Kroger posted the recall of High Noon Beach Variety 12-Packs because cans labeled as Celsius Astro Vibe Energy Drink might have vodka spritzer instead.
